Liang Bua Ruteng - Hobbit Cave Flores that Saves History

​​​​​​​Liang Bua is one of the caves in the limestone hill in the Manggarai region. Liang Bua has a very large size, which is 50 meters long, 40 meters wide and 25 meters high. With the size of the Liang Bua is very large, people have used it as a place of worship and school.

Rangko Cave - A Private Swimming Pool In Labuan Bajo
Rangko Cave - Private pool formRangko Cave is like a private swimming pool that offers silence for anyone who stops by to feel the freshness of the water in it. The water contained in the cave is salt water. The water is sourced from sea water, this is because there are cavities or fissures that connect the pond in the cave with the high seas. The upper part of Rangko Cave is full of beautiful stalactite ornaments with various irregular shapes.
